The artwork of the month of May is the 65x21x12 cm wooden work by sculptor András Kós, In front of the curtain.

András Kós celebrated the 110th anniversary of his birth in 2024, and the travelling exhibitionnwas created as part of this occasion, and the carving entitled In front of the curtain was exhibited as part of it. Kós András carries on the great legacy of his father, Károly Kós, and his art reflects the diverse motifs of Hungarian folk art, the sensitive and romantic style, the handicraft, the chirada, folk decoration. However, András Kós's art is an autonomous and independent art. While we can recognise the heritage in his sculptures, we can recognise in the oeuvre treated in the exhibition the self-asserted greatness that his sculptures represent.

The work of the month is an oak carving of two female figures, of medium size compared to the other works. The carving does not explore the wood's gifts, not in the tradition of Renaissance pathos, to discover a sculpture "locked" in the material; but rather, it shapes the desired forms according to its own definite ideas. The elongated bodies do not insist on conforming to reality, they do not want to be lifelike, thus, they are airy, light, free and almost like Chagallian lovers flying.
